How to Automatically Backup Photos from Nokia Lumia to OneDrive?

OneDrive (previously SkyDrive) is a cloud storage service which allows you to upload and sync photos, videos & files to a cloud storage and then access them from a Web browser or their local device. OneDrive has a feature 'Automatic Upload' which allows you to automatically upload photos to OneDrive from your Nokia Lumia. It offers 7GB of free storage space to all its users. You can earn up to 5 GB of free storage space for referring new users (500 MB each) to OneDrive. You can also earn 3 GB of free storage space, when you enable 'Automatic uploads' using the OneDrive mobile app.

Following are the steps to automatically backup photos from Nokia Lumia to SkyDrive:

  1. Go to https://onedrive.live.com & sign in to your account. If you don't have an account, then create one.
  2. Download "OneDrive App" on your phone from the App store & launch it.
  3. Tap "Start" button to go to the start screen on Nokia Lumia phone.
  4. Go to "Pictures".
  5. Tap "..." (3 horizontal dots) located at the bottom right side corner on your phone screen.
  6. Tap "Settings" & select "Applications" option.
  7. Move the slider from left to right to turn ON "Automatically upload to SkyDrive".
  8. You will be prompted with a message that says "This may use your data plan, and may incur charges" & click "Yes".
  9. All your photos will now be automatically uploaded to SkyDrive.
